Early Life and Family Dynamics
Tyrus, whose birth name is George Murdoch, was born on February 21, 1973, in Boston, Massachusetts, United States. Interestingly, some sources also list Pasadena, California, as his birthplace. He was born to young parents, with his African American father being 19 years old at the time and his mother, who was 15 and white, raising him. So, his parents were quite young when he came into the world, which, in some respects, set the stage for a unique family situation.
His early life was further complicated by his racial identity, and this is important. In 2018, Murdoch shared a childhood incident where his abusive father damaged his eye by hitting him. This very serious incident led his mother to leave his father, basically. His father is of African American descent, while his mother is of Caucasian descent, and that's a key part of his story.
As a biracial child, he faced rejection and discrimination from his maternal grandparents, who were white. Tyrus's grandfather allowed his mom, who was white, to move back home, but not Tyrus and his brother because their father was black. This, you know, was a very tough experience for him and his brother, two biracial kids, early on in their lives. This background indicates that George is biracial, clearly.

Personal Details and Biography
Here's a quick look at some key facts about Tyrus, just a little, to give you a clearer picture of his personal details.
Birth Name | George Murdoch |
Known As | Tyrus, Brodus Clay, The Funkasaurus, The Super Sexy Suplex |
Date of Birth | February 21, 1973 |
Age (as of 2023) | 50 years old |
Birthplace | Boston, Massachusetts, United States (also Pasadena, California cited) |
Nationality | American |
Ethnicity | Biracial (Mixed: Black & White) |
Father's Ethnicity | African American |
Mother's Ethnicity | Caucasian |
Height | 6 feet 9 inches (206 cm) |
Weight | 370 lbs (168 kg) |
Zodiac Sign | Pisces |
Occupation | Television political commentator, Actor, Professional wrestler |
